For alert configuration see the belowlinks,.But in your case if the send message having the empty fields, we can handle this in FCC parameters
xml.fieldoptional = yes
Parameter NameA.fieldFixedLengths defined.
&#9675;       If the inbound structure contains more fields than in NameA.fieldNames or NameA.fieldFixedLengths the conversion is executed.
Additional fields in the structure are ignored.
&#9675;       If the inbound structure contains less fields than specified in NameA.fieldNames, conversion is terminated with an error message.
If the last field only is shorter than defined or is missing completely, the conversion is executed. The contents of the last field are then applied to the XML element as found. Consequently, the value can be incomplete or empty.

    Hi Freddy,
    I think you might like to specify missingLastFields = add. then it will add the missing fields as empty. you can further check if these are empty in mapping and then fail the message or create an alert.
    If you specify "ignore" then you will not get those fields in your structure and if you specify "error" then the file will not be picked up.
    have a look here
    http://help.sap.com/saphelp_nw04/helpdata/en/2c/181077dd7d6b4ea6a8029b20bf7e55/content.htm
    missingLastfields
    If the inbound structure has less fields than specified in the configuration then the XML outbound structure is created as follows:
    ○       ignore
    Outbound structure only contains the fields in the inbound structure
    ○       add
    Outbound structure contains all fields from the configuration; the fields missing in the inbound structure are empty.
    ○       error
    Conversion is terminated due to the incomplete inbound structure. An error message is displayed
